Company Description

Ulbrich Stainless Steels & Special Metals, Inc. is a high-precision, value added processor of Stainless Steels, Nickel Alloys, Titanium Alloys, Cobalt Alloys, Niobium, Tantalum, Nitinol for a wide range of difficult-to-manufacture, niche-market applications such as aerospace jet engine seals, nuclear reactor fuel cages, heart pacemaker containers, PV ribbon, computer chip substrate, chemical processing tower components, automotive airbag burst disks, automotive oxygen sensors, medical catheters, and cell phone key pads.

Ulbrich was established in 1924 and is privately held. It has 9 subsidiaries located in the US, Mexico, Canada, and Austria employs over 700 people worldwide.  Our continued growth and expansion translates into career opportunities in many areas and locations. 

Job Description

Located in Alsip, Ulbrich of Illinois is a full-line stainless steel service center.  We have an exciting opportunity for an experienced Controller, who will be responsible for overseeing all company accounting operations including preparing financial reports, maintaining accounting records, and conducting financial analyses.

Specific responsibilities include:

  • Directing all general accounting activities for the division including general ledger, A/P, A/R, invoicing, financial statement preparation, financial records/files, taxes, fixed assets, capital expenditures, bank, cash management and other financial audits;
  • Directing annual physical inventory and cycle counts;
  • Preparing and monitoring annual budget and forecasts in conjunction with annual financial goals/strategies;
  • Proactively monitoring monthly and quarterly financial performance and making appropriate recommendations to achieve desired profit objectives;
  • Provide reporting and support for year-end audit and other audits throughout the year;
  • Providing financial analysis tools to evaluate company ventures on special projects, programs, capital expenditures, and product costing; and
  • Preparing reports and analyses for presentation to Ulbrich management.

Qualifications

Qualified candidates will possess a Bachelor’s Degree in Accounting plus a minimum of 7 years’ experience in a manufacturing or distribution environment and a minimum of 3 years of staff management experience. Working knowledge of supply chain and/or materials is a plus. CPA or Public Accounting experience preferred.  This position requires strong leadership, analytical ability, demonstrated organizational and planning skills. Qualified candidates must possess effective verbal and written communication skills and intermediate skills with MS Office (particularly Excel). Bilingual, English/Spanish preferred, but not required.
